问题标签 [osx-yosemite]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
1890 浏览

macos - OS X 10.10 Yosemite - 添加菜单

我是 OSX 编程的新手,最近开始了一个 OS X 10.10 的演示项目。找到这个 -> http://cocoatutorial.grapewave.com/tag/menulet/在 OSX 状态栏中添加 menulet 的好教程。问题是我的项目使用的是 swift 语言,方法和项目结构/文件有些不同。我想知道是否有人在优胜美地上成功尝试过这个?谢谢。

编辑:具体问题是如何替换 awakefromnib 方法以使用当前的 AppDelegate.swift 语法?

0 投票
1 回答
6326 浏览

swift - 斯威夫特:不能使用 NSImage .imageNamed

当我执行以下操作时,我看到 imageNamed 已从可用选项中弃用(或删除):

在此处输入图像描述

我已经尝试过 Apple 提供的 Swift 文档和其他放置的文档。这似乎很琐碎,但找不到 imageNamed 的解决方案。我错过了什么吗?

0 投票
1 回答
1311 浏览

xcode - 带有新 OS 10.10 Yosemite 的 Xcode 5.1 在屏幕上显示青色圆圈

我已经安装了新操作系统 Yosemite 的开发者预览版。Xcode 5.1.1,然后我做了 10.10 更新。执行更新并重新启动后,当我打开 Xcode 5.1.1 时,我会看到这个青色圆圈,旁边有一个十字线。我不能移动它也不能关闭它。

有没有人知道如何删除它或遇到同样的问题。

我的屏幕截图可在此链接获得:http: //i.stack.imgur.com/sK7JK.jpg

0 投票
1 回答
423 浏览

ruby - 如何重新安装系统Ruby?

不幸的是,我设法在 OS X Yosemite 上删除了我的系统 Ruby,我正在努力重新安装它。

我已阅读此处详细说明的答案:

但是,当我使用Pacifist尝试恢复 Ruby.framework 时,应用程序会像这样挂起:

和平主义者拖延

是否有任何其他方法可以获取适用于 OS X Yosemite 的 Ruby 2.0 并重新安装它?任何帮助将非常感激。

0 投票
2 回答
110 浏览

xcode - “open -h”找不到标题

自从我安装了 Xcode 6 beta 后,当我输入open -h {header}. 典型的交互如下所示:

我可以找到标题,它们在 Xcode SDK 包中很深,这很好,但open -h似乎不知道这个位置。有人知道如何解决这个问题吗?

0 投票
2 回答
976 浏览

ios - OS X Yosemite 使用 XCode5 代码签名错误提交应用程序

我使用 os x yosemite 和 XCode 5,我想将我的应用程序提交到 appstore,但我看到这样的错误

“主可执行文件或 Info.plist 必须是常规文件(无符号链接等)”

在此处输入图像描述

你能帮助我吗 ?

提前致谢 ...

0 投票
3 回答
13884 浏览

macos - 如何在窗口的标题栏中使用 NSVisualEffectView?

在 OS X Yosemite 中,Apple 引入了一个新的类NSVisualEffectView. 目前,这个类没有文档,但我们可以在 Interface Builder 中使用它。

如何NSVisualEffectView在窗口的标题栏中使用?

下面是示例:在 Safari 中,当您滚动时,内容会出现在工具栏和标题栏下方,并带有活力和模糊效果。

在此处输入图像描述

0 投票
1 回答
563 浏览

javascript - Polymer-Project 对象未在 OS X 10.10 中呈现

最近我一直在考虑在我正在进行的项目中使用 Polymer 元素。但是,我看不到在 OS X 10.10 Yosemite 的新 beta 版 safari 中呈现的任何元素。我完全理解 Yosemite 和 Safari 目前处于 DP 阶段,但我很好奇为什么新版本的 Safari 破坏了与 Polymer 元素的兼容性(我可以确认 Polymer 元素在 Mavericks 版本的 Safari 中工作)。

我能够打开开发者控制台并发现错误。我目前无法找到确切的错误,但我知道错误出现在第 57 行的 patch-mdv.js 中,声称是只读错误。

我刚刚在我的 iPhone 上使用 iOS8 测试了 Polymer Project 网站,得到了相同的结果。

有没有人知道我可以做些什么来临时解决这个问题,直到 Polymer-Project 团队修复它?

0 投票
1 回答
394 浏览

objective-c - 似乎无法在 Mac 上编译铬嵌入式框架

尝试在 Yosemite Developer Preview 上编译 Chromium Embedded 框架时出现了一些涉及[NSApp setDelegate:self];cefsimple_mac.mm 的错误:

cefsimple_mac.mm:93:22:不兼容的指针类型将“SimpleAppDelegate *”发送到“id”类型的参数

显然不是解决方案,但将其注释掉也会在代码中提供更多这些错误。

我在 Mac Developer Pre-Release 库中查找了 NSApp setDelegate ,它似乎在 10.10 中不再按预期工作(我不想说已弃用,因为我的内存不足,只知道它被划掉了)。

有谁知道我可以解决这个问题的方法?

0 投票
1 回答
411 浏览

osx-yosemite - 在 Mac OS 10.10 上安装 Xiki

有人在 Mac OS Yosemite 上成功安装过 Xiki 吗?开发人员的建议是它只与 Ruby 1.9.3 兼容,但 Yosemite 附带 2.0.0,我无法为 Mac OS 10.10 成功构建 1.9.3(没有预烘焙的二进制文件,这不足为奇)。